Key Features of the Summer Camp Emergency Information Sheet
The Summer Camp Emergency Information Sheet includes a variety of essential fields that need to be filled out, such as:
-
Child's Name
-
Birthdate
-
Emergency Contacts
-
Medical Conditions
-
Allergies
-
Special Needs
-
Transportation Authorization
-
Swimming Pool Level Permission
Each section is carefully designed to gather comprehensive information, helping camp staff prepare for any circumstances. The inclusion of transportation and swimming permissions further ensures that parents are actively engaged in safety decisions.

Who is required to fill out the Summer Camp Emergency Information Sheet?
The form is required to be filled out by parents or guardians of children attending summer camp to ensure the safety and well-being of their child.
What information must I provide on the emergency information sheet?
You need to provide your child's name, birthdate, address, emergency contacts, medical conditions, allergies, and special needs.
Is there a deadline for submitting the Summer Camp Emergency Information Sheet?
Yes, it is best to submit the form as early as possible, generally before the start of the camp, to ensure camp staff have ample time to process the information.
Can I fill out the form multiple times if changes are needed?
Yes, you can update the form in pdfFiller if there are any changes in your child's medical condition, emergency contacts, or other relevant details.
What should I do if I forget to include information on the form?
If you notice omissions after submission, contact the camp administration promptly to update the emergency contact sheet with the required information.
